
Ahead of his performance at this year's CMA Fest, taking place June 9 through 12 in Nashville and airing Wednesday, August 3 at 8PM ET /7PM CT on ABC, singer Travis Denning took a look back at some of his most memorable fan interactions while chatting backstage with Audacy host Katie Neal.
LISTEN: Travis Denning talks fan memories @ CMA Fest
Travis, performing June 9 at the 2022 CMA Fest, tells Katie that "even today, I signed a man's chest... bare chest," leading her to rightly wonder, "what is he gonna do with that?" Admittedly, Travis has signed plenty of body parts, "as far as legs and arms and stuff like that," he says. "I dunno... that may be crazy."
Another memory he offered was after one of his recent concerts in North Carolina was rescheduled, and since he had nothing better to do, Travis says he decided to do some karaoke with fans that he ran into -- and even gave them upgraded seats for the updated date. "My go-to karaoke song is 'Brown Chicken, Brown Cow," by Trace Adkins -- but you also gotta feel the crowd a little bit, and it was rockin', so I went with the smash hit "Smooth" by Santana and Rob Thomas... nobody ever expects "Brown Chicken, Brown Cow!"
Travis was recently engaged in a beautiful Central Park proposal in New York, and has been embracing all of the tasty planning chores that come along. Playlists are also being considered; "she's doing all that," Travis admits, "but there are some songs like... none of my songs, none of John Michael's songs, none of Walker's songs, none of uncle Eddie's songs!" For those unaware: Travis is engaged to wed to "I Swear" singer John Michael Montgomery's daughter, Madison, just one of many reasons why so many of his songs will likely be chosen for their wedding playlist!
